Ricerca di contatti, progetti,
corsi e pubblicazioni

Introduction to Programming

Persone

Binder W.

Docente titolare del corso

Javed O.

Assistente

Descrizione

This course - aimed at students without prior programming experience - gives an introduction to programming with the Java programming language. It explains fundamental approaches to algorithmic problem solving. Students learn about declarative problem specification and procedural problem solving. The course focuses on procedural programming, but introduces also the basic concepts of object-oriented programming. It covers the software development phases of problem specification, software design, programming, testing, and debugging.

 

 

REFERENCES

  • Objects First with Java - A Practical Introduction using BlueJ; David J. Barnes & Michael Kölling; Sixth edition; Pearson Education, 2017 (ISBN-13: 978-0-13-447736-7)

Offerta formativa